I have completed the head change on my 90 Carat. The van has 176k miles and the heads have been leaking for about 10k miles. Haven't driven the van since July of 01. A couple of weekend ago my brother, his son and I pulled the old heads and installed new ones. The heads that were pulled appeared to be in very good condition with very tiny cracks between the valve seats, which according to the Bentley does not affect the performance or life of the heads. I an going to have these head checked by a professional and if okay, have them cleaned and reconditioned for use on one of our other vans (we have five Syncros and the Carat in the family).

When we pulled the first head, we inadvertently pulled one of the cylinder sleeves out too far and in trying to put it back we broke one of the rings. I ordered a set from Ken at VanAgain and we installed them the next weekend. We did not want to pull the pistons, so we used the method suggested by many list members. We installed the new rings and then using a large hose clamp to compress the rings, we carefully reinstalled the cylinder sleeve. We could not believe how quick and smooth the job went.

So now after more than a year the Carat is back on the road and running great. I bought this van new in 1990 and this is the first time I have worked on the engine. I have NEVER changed the distributor cap and rotor or the fuel injectors, in fact I have done very little to this van except change the synthic oil every 50,000 miles and the spark plugs about every 20,000 miles. The coolant was changed once in 92 and never again since until this head change. I have driven this vehicle hard for 11 years and 176,000 miles with very little maintenance and it has served me well, I don't believe it owes me anything. I use the lowest octane gas at Sam's or Costco or wherever when they are not available.
